BP fined for poor disclosure on acquisition

BP, the UK petrol giant, has been fined €35,000 ($34,450) for inadequate disclosure of key data about an acquisition it made two years ago.

The European Commission fined Deutsche BP, the group's German arm, for providing incomplete information to its merger taskforce on the purchase of a 50% stake in Erdölchemie, a petrochemicals plant near Cologne.
